Common Causes of Water Damage
Roof Leaks
-
Damaged shingles or flashing
-
Cracks around chimneys, vents, or skylights
-
Aging roofs
Foundation and Basement Issues
-
Poor drainage around property
-
Cracks in foundation walls
-
Water seepage during heavy rains
Exterior Walls and Siding
-
Cracks in masonry or stucco
-
Aging sealants around windows and doors
-
Gaps in exterior cladding
Bathrooms and Kitchens
-
Improper sealing around fixtures
-
Damaged waterproof membranes
-
Pipe leaks or faulty appliances

Types of Waterproofing Solutions
Roof Waterproofing
-
Sealant application to prevent leaks
-
Protective coatings to resist UV and weathering
-
Inspection and repair of damaged shingles, flashing, and joints
Basement and Foundation Waterproofing
-
Interior or exterior membranes
-
Drainage systems to divert water away from foundations
-
Crack injections and structural reinforcements
Wall and Exterior Waterproofing
-
Masonry sealants and liquid-applied membranes
-
Prevent water infiltration through cracks or porous surfaces
-
Suitable for both new construction and existing structures
Balcony and Terrace Waterproofing
-
Layered membranes or coatings
-
Ensures proper slope for drainage
-
Prevents ponding and leaks
Bathroom and Wet Area Waterproofing
-
Waterproof membranes for showers, tubs, and floors
-
Prevents moisture penetration into walls and subfloor
-
Ensures long-term protection against mold and rot

The Waterproofing Process
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
-
Evaluate affected areas and property layout
-
Identify water intrusion points and vulnerabilities
-
Determine appropriate waterproofing method
Step 2: Surface Preparation
-
Clean and dry surfaces
-
Remove damaged or loose materials
-
Repair minor cracks or deterioration
Step 3: Application of Waterproofing Materials
-
Membranes, coatings, sealants, or liquid applications
-
Ensure uniform coverage and adhesion
-
Apply multiple layers for added protection
Step 4: Testing and Quality Assurance
-
Check for leaks or weak points
-
Confirm proper drainage and sealing
-
Ensure compliance with industry standards
Step 5: Maintenance Guidance
-
Provide advice on periodic inspection
-
Recommend protective measures to extend service life

Seasonal Considerations
Winter
-
Ice and snow can cause roof leaks and foundation cracks
-
Waterproofing protects against freeze-thaw cycles
Spring
-
Heavy rains test roof, wall, and foundation integrity
-
Prevent basement flooding and dampness
Summer
-
UV-resistant coatings prevent roof and wall degradation
-
Regular inspection prevents hidden leaks
Fall
-
Prepare for winter with sealing, gutter cleaning, and membrane inspection
Maintenance Tips for Longevity
-
Regular inspections of roof, walls, and foundations
-
Clean gutters and drainage systems
-
Repair minor cracks promptly
-
Reapply protective coatings as recommended by professionals
-
Ensure proper ventilation to reduce condensation
